When is the very best season for tree trimming?
The very best season for clipping really depends upon the sort of tree and the region you reside in. Generally, it's ideal to have a tree trimmer cut your trees while they are dormant.
Wintertime tree maintenance is good due to the fact that the rest of your backyard and landscape require minimal treatment at this time. Cutting back trees before fresh spring growth emerges puts lower stress on trees, and can help with hearty growth through the spring and summertime.
It's still perfectly fine to cut back, thin and shape trees in the spring and summertime also, particularly if there is any dead wood, illness, or overgrowth.
Palm Tree Trimming
One needs to be careful when maintaining palm trees. Cutting them incorrectly or when the leaves are green can leave them vulnerable to diseases and bugs. Palm trees need to be cut when the oldest leaves on the tree have died and turned dry. This is normally one or two times each year.
Yearly maintenance will certainly help keep trees in good condition, and prevent accidents and injuries from dropping fronds.
Pine Tree Trimming
The best time for pine tree cutting is in the very early springtime, though if you detect dead or infected branches, it's best to have those cut down to stop issues from spreading.
It is very important to use correct trimming techniques. Cutting back branches to shorten them, is not a good plan. It can stop the growth of the branch entirely and cause it to appear stunted.
Pinching back brand-new growth tips in the springtime can help give pine trees an eye-catching dense and compact growth pattern.
